Why Regular HVAC Service is Crucial in Fremont
Fremont's climate is characterized by mild, wet winters and warm, dry summers. While we don't experience the extreme temperature swings seen in desert or mountainous regions, our systems see consistent, year-round use 1. This steady demand makes preventative care not just a good idea, but a practical necessity. A well-maintained system is less likely to fail during the first heatwave of summer or a chilly winter night, preventing inconvenient and often costly emergency repairs 2.
The primary benefits of scheduling routine maintenance are improved efficiency and extended equipment life. During a tune-up, a technician cleans critical components and makes adjustments that allow your system to use less energy to heat or cool your home. This directly translates to lower monthly utility bills. Furthermore, catching minor issues-like a loose electrical connection or a small refrigerant leak-early can prevent them from escalating into major component failures, thereby maximizing the lifespan of your entire HVAC system 3 4.
What to Expect During a Professional Tune-Up
A comprehensive HVAC maintenance visit is a systematic process. A qualified technician will perform a series of checks, cleanings, and tests to assess your system's health. While the exact checklist may vary by provider, a thorough service typically includes several key areas.
Cleaning and Inspection: This forms the foundation of any good tune-up. The technician will clean the evaporator and condenser coils, which are vital for heat exchange; dirty coils force your system to work harder. Air filters will be checked and replaced if needed. The condensate drain line will be cleared to prevent water damage and mold growth, and burners (on a furnace) will be cleaned for optimal operation.
System Testing and Calibration: The electrical side of your system gets a close look. This includes inspecting and tightening electrical connections, testing capacitors and contactors, and verifying all safety controls are functioning correctly. The technician will also check refrigerant levels, measure system airflow, and calibrate your thermostat to ensure it's reading temperatures accurately.
Performance Verification and Adjustments: Finally, the technician will start up the system and monitor its operation. They will listen for unusual noises, check for proper cycling, and ensure the heat exchanger (in a furnace) is operating safely. Any necessary adjustments, such as lubricating moving parts or adjusting belt tension, will be made to ensure everything is running smoothly 5.
Recommended Service Frequency for Fremont Homes
How often should you schedule this essential service? For most Fremont households, an annual HVAC tune-up is the standard recommendation 6. The ideal timing is seasonally: schedule air conditioning service in the spring before the summer heat arrives, and furnace service in the fall before the winter chill sets in. This pre-season approach ensures your system is prepared for peak demand.
Some homeowners and HVAC professionals opt for a bi-annual schedule, with one visit for the cooling system and a separate visit for the heating system 7. This can be particularly beneficial for systems that see heavy use or are older. Ultimately, following the maintenance schedule suggested by your equipment manufacturer and consulting with a trusted local technician will provide the best guidance for your specific home and system.

Understanding Costs for HVAC Maintenance
The cost of a tune-up in Fremont can vary based on the scope of service, the provider, and whether you're on a maintenance plan. Generally, you can expect a range.
A basic tune-up, covering essential safety checks, filter replacement, and minor cleaning, might range from approximately $75 to $200 8 9. A more comprehensive maintenance visit, which includes deeper cleaning of coils and components, advanced diagnostics, and more detailed performance testing, often falls between $150 and $350 10 8.
Many local companies offer prepaid maintenance plans or service agreements. These plans typically provide two scheduled tune-ups per year (spring and fall), priority scheduling, discounts on repairs, and sometimes waived service fees. Enrolling in a plan can offer convenience, potential cost savings over time, and the peace of mind that comes with regular, professional care.
The Value of Local, Professional Service
While some homeowners may consider DIY maintenance, the complexity and safety risks of modern HVAC systems make professional service a wise choice. Certified technicians have the training, tools, and expertise to perform tasks you shouldn't, such as handling refrigerants or inspecting high-voltage electrical components and heat exchangers for dangerous cracks 11.
Choosing a local Fremont-based provider means you're working with professionals who understand our specific microclimates and common HVAC challenges in the area. They can offer tailored advice and are readily available should you need follow-up service or emergency repairs. This local expertise ensures your system receives care that's appropriate for the environmental conditions it operates in day after day.
